> >I am working on a Dell OptiPlex GX280 that up till last week worked fine
> >(~3
> > years). 1GB RAM, 2.8GB Pentium, 80GB HDD SATA, CD-RW, XP SP2. Is a
> > network
> > workstation. Virus & malware signatures updates hourly. Has decent
> > firewall. Recently had added second 512MB RAM strip, but ran with no
> > issues
> > for weeks following. Run MS Updates routinely, but not yet loaded XP SP3
> > (it
> > was not yet released at time hang/freeze issue began). Has suddenly begun
> > to
> > hang/freeze at about 2-3 minutes post log-in. Gives no warning, no error
> > messages, no error beeps, continues all green lights on back panel.
> > Initially reset to earlier restore point with no positive effect. Then
> > did
> > repair of OS with no positive effect. Ran Dell Diagnostics which found no
> > hardware issues - all tests passed. Specifically retested Memory and HDD
> > and
> > all still passed those further diagnostics. Have tested USB keyboard and
> > USB
> > mouse separately and both are fully functional. Ultimately reformatted
> > HDD
> > and did clean install, but still continues to hang/freeze at about 2-3
> > minutes post log-in. Can boot to CD and during lengthy OS repair or
> > install
> > there was no hang. Can boot to Safe Mode and device will eventually
> > hang/freeze at about 10-12 minutes post log-in. When hang begins, red
> > light
> > on optical mouse flickers (slow at first then increases to rapid, then
> > suddenly stops); also during this, audio begins to crackle and similarly
> > increases in pace, then stops same as mouse optic light. Did find some
> > info
> > @ MS regarding an "interrupt storm" but the prescribed "fix" for that did
> > not
> > alter my issue in any way. Presently the GX280 still hangs/freezes and
> > nothing I've done has resolved the issue.
> >
> > Has anyone suffered through this type of problem before, and how did you
> > ultimately resolve it?
